Preparation method of moisture-curing reaction type polyurethane hot melt adhesive for textiles
A technology of polyurethane hot melt adhesive and polyurethane adhesive, which is applied in the direction of polyurea/polyurethane adhesive, adhesive, adhesive type, etc., can solve the problems of high surface energy, poor wettability, high melt viscosity, etc., and achieve high Good initial and final tack strength, high and low temperature resistance, and excellent overall performance

Embodiment 1
[0023] Embodiment 1: a kind of preparation method of moisture-curing reactive polyurethane hot-melt adhesive for textiles, comprises the following steps:
[0024] S1. Synthesis of polyurethane prepolymer: Stir polyether polyol or polyester polyol evenly, heat up to 150°C, keep the vacuum degree above 0.09MPa for dehydration, and drop the temperature below 80°C; then, add diisocyanate, Make the reaction system react at 60°C, vacuum defoam to obtain a polyurethane prepolymer; control the mass content of isocyanate groups in the polyurethane prepolymer to 2g / 100g;
[0025] S2. Preparation of polyurethane adhesive: mix polyurethane prepolymer with thermoplastic polyurethane elastomer, stir and heat up to 70°C; dissolve polyurethane in silane coupling agent, and disperse by ultrasonic; add polyurethane dropwise to polyurethane prepolymer , and add a catalyst, react at 80°C for 2 hours, mix and stir to obtain a polyurethane adhesive;
